Set up supervised child accounts

Parents who decide that their child under 13 (or the relevant age in their country/region) is ready to explore YouTube can set up a supervised child account. Supervised child accounts can be created on a shared device with a signed-in parent or with a signed-in Google Account that is linked to a parent's own Google Account if the child is using YouTube on their own device.

In both cases, when a parent sets up a supervised child account, they select a content setting that limits the videos and music that their child has access to. Learn more about supervised child accounts.

Create a supervised child account

Choose one of these options to create a supervised account:

Option 1: From the YouTube app on a parent's device

Note: Creating a supervised child account on a parent's device does not require creating a Google Account for your child.
Note: Creating a supervised child account on a parent's device does not grant access to YouTube Music. For access, your child will need to have a signed-in Google Account using the other options detailed below.
  1.  Sign in to the YouTube app using your Google Account.
  2. Navigate to the Family Centre option under Settings.
  3. Choose 'add a child account'.
  4. Follow the steps to create a supervised child account.
  5. Once created, you can seamlessly switch between the supervised child and parent accounts on your YouTube app through the 'Who's watching' page or via the 'Switch account' option in the You tab.

Option 2: From YouTube or YouTube Music on a child's device

Note: Before creating a supervised child account, make sure that you've created a Google Account for them.
  1. Sign in to the main YouTube app, the YouTube Music app or the YouTube app on a smart TV or streaming device. Use your child's Google Account that's linked to yours.
  2. Select GET STARTED and follow the next steps.
    • Note: You'll need to enter your own Google Account password to give permission.

Option 3: From families.youtube.com on the web

Note: Before creating a supervised child account, make sure that you've created a Google Account for them.
  1. Go to families.youtube.com.
  2. Sign in to the Google Account that you use as a parent manager of your child's account.
  3. Select a child from your family group and follow the next steps.

Option 4: From the Family Link app

Note: Before creating a supervised child account, make sure that you've created a Google Account for them.
  1. Sign in to your Family Link app Family Link.
  2. Select your child.
  3. Select Controls and then YouTube and then YouTube and YouTube Music.
  4. Follow the on-screen instructions.

Get started

To begin watching YouTube under a supervised child account on a parent's device: Use the 'Who's watching' page or 'Switch account' option in the You tab to select the correct profile.

On your child's device: Sign in to YouTube using their account.

There are several parental controls and settings available for supervised child accounts.
